Early Life and Career Beginnings

Simone Bolelli was born on October 8, 1985 in Bologna, Emilia-Romagna, Italy. From a young age, he showed a natural talent for tennis and began playing competitively at a young age. His parents, Stefania and Daniele Bolelli, were supportive of his passion for the sport and encouraged him to pursue his dreams.

Rise to Prominence

Bolelli’s talent on the tennis court quickly caught the attention of coaches and scouts, and he began to rise through the ranks of the junior tennis circuit. In 2003, he turned professional and started competing in ATP tournaments around the world. His powerful serve and aggressive playing style made him a force to be reckoned with on the court.

Playing Style

Bolelli is known for his aggressive playing style, which is characterized by powerful serves, strong groundstrokes, and a willingness to take risks on the court. He is also a skilled doubles player, with excellent net skills and a keen sense of positioning.
